Japan Traditional Hall Current Sensor Market Size & Forecast (2026-2033)

Japan Traditional Hall Current Sensor Market Size Analysis: Addressable Demand and Growth Potential

The Japan traditional hall current sensor market presents a compelling growth trajectory driven by technological adoption, industrial modernization, and increasing automation across key sectors. To quantify this potential, a comprehensive TAM, SAM, and SOM analysis provides clarity on market scope, realistic penetration, and future opportunities.

  • Total Addressable Market (TAM): – Estimated at approximately JPY 45 billion (USD 400 million) as of 2023. – Based on global demand for Hall current sensors, with Japan accounting for roughly 15-20% of the Asia-Pacific market, which itself is valued at around USD 2 billion. – Key sectors include industrial automation, automotive, energy, and consumer electronics.
  • Serviceable Available Market (SAM): – Focused on segments with high adoption potential such as industrial machinery, renewable energy systems, and electric vehicles within Japan. – Estimated at approximately JPY 20 billion (USD 180 million). – Driven by Japan’s push toward Industry 4.0, smart manufacturing, and clean energy initiatives.
  • Serviceable Obtainable Market (SOM): – Realistically, within the next 3-5 years, capturing about 20-25% of the SAM is feasible, considering competitive landscape and market entry barriers. – Projected SOM of around JPY 4-5 billion (USD 36-45 million). – This reflects early market penetration, strategic partnerships, and targeted customer segments.

Market segmentation logic hinges on application verticals, customer types, and regional deployment within Japan’s industrial hubs such as Tokyo, Osaka, and Nagoya. Adoption rates are expected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 7-9% over the next five years, driven by technological upgrades and regulatory mandates for energy efficiency and safety compliance.

Japan Traditional Hall Current Sensor Market Commercialization Outlook & Revenue Opportunities

The commercialization landscape for Hall current sensors in Japan is characterized by high-value applications, strategic partnerships, and evolving regulatory frameworks. Understanding revenue streams and operational dynamics is critical for sustainable growth.

  • Business Model Attractiveness & Revenue Streams: – Primarily driven by B2B sales to OEMs, system integrators, and industrial end-users. – Recurring revenue from sensor component sales, technical support, and calibration services. – Potential for licensing proprietary sensing technology to global players targeting the Japanese market.
  • Growth Drivers & Demand Acceleration Factors: – Japan’s aggressive adoption of Industry 4.0 and smart manufacturing initiatives. – Rising demand for electric vehicles and energy-efficient power management solutions. – Government policies promoting renewable energy, grid modernization, and safety standards.
  • Segment-wise Opportunities:Industrial Automation: High-volume demand for precise current measurement in robotics and factory automation. – Automotive: Growing EV market requiring compact, reliable sensors for battery management and motor control. – Energy & Power: Smart grids, renewable energy inverters, and energy storage systems offer scalable revenue avenues. – Customer Types: OEMs, Tier-1 suppliers, system integrators, and end-user industrial firms.
  • Scalability Challenges & Operational Bottlenecks: – Supply chain disruptions affecting component sourcing. – Need for high-precision manufacturing and quality control to meet Japanese standards. – Limited local R&D capacity for rapid innovation cycles.
  • Regulatory Landscape, Certifications & Compliance: – Compliance with Japan’s PSE (Product Safety) certification and IEC standards. – Evolving regulations around energy efficiency and safety standards for electrical components. – Certification timelines may impact go-to-market schedules but also serve as barriers to entry for less compliant competitors.

Japan Traditional Hall Current Sensor Market Trends & Recent Developments

Staying abreast of industry trends and recent developments is vital for strategic positioning in Japan’s competitive landscape.

  • Technological Innovations & Product Launches: – Introduction of miniaturized, high-precision Hall sensors with integrated signal conditioning. – Development of sensors with enhanced temperature stability and EMI immunity suitable for harsh environments. – Integration with IoT platforms for real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ance.
  • Strategic Partnerships, Mergers & Acquisitions: – Collaborations between sensor manufacturers and Japanese automotive OEMs to co-develop next-gen EV sensors. – M&A activity aimed at consolidating supply chains and expanding technological capabilities. – Alliances with electronics giants to embed sensors into broader automation and energy management systems.
  • Regulatory Updates & Policy Changes: – Japan’s Green Growth Strategy emphasizing renewable energy and energy efficiency standards. – New safety regulations mandating sensor integration in critical infrastructure. – Potential policy incentives for domestic manufacturing and R&D investments.
  • Competitive Landscape Shifts: – Entry of global sensor players leveraging advanced manufacturing and AI-driven quality control. – Increased focus on differentiation through product reliability, miniaturization, and integration capabilities. – Local startups gaining traction with innovative sensing solutions tailored for niche applications.
